How Create and Publish NPM Packages

Поділитися
Вставка
  • Опубліковано 4 лют 2025
  • Ever wondered how to create and publish NPM packages that millions of JavaScript developers across the world can use? Creating and publishing NPM Packages is much simpler than you might think. It's as simple as creating an account, creating a repository, and connecting them together. You'll have your first NPM package published in just a few minutes!
    NPM Business Card Source Code - github.com/jam...
    _____________________________________________
    Newsletter 🗞
    Interested in exclusive content and discounts? 🤯 Sign up for the newsletter!
    www.jamesqquic...
    _____________________________________________
    Connect with me 😀
    Live streams on Twitch - / jamesqquick
    Follow me on Twitter - / jamesqquick
    Join the 💬 Discord Server 💬 - / discord
    _____________________________________________
    COURSES 💻
    Learn how to build Fullstack apps with React and Serverless Functions - www.jamesqquic...
    Learn everything you need to know about Visual Studio Code - www.udemy.com/...
    Build a Quiz App - www.udemy.com/...

КОМЕНТАРІ • 35

  • @JamesQQuick
    @JamesQQuick  4 роки тому +4

    Comment below with your favorite JavaScript NPM packages!

  • @jamesdanielmalvern
    @jamesdanielmalvern Рік тому

    thank you! this is the only vid I found so far that actually works and contains each part of the process that you need.

  • @nicolasomar
    @nicolasomar 2 роки тому

    I will work on a npm packate to wrap an UI library + React + Typescript.
    This video helped me to get more into it before code the first component. Thanks to you, this kind of work seems much more understandable that just heading into the documentation.
    I will save this for future reference.

  • @garrettw6718
    @garrettw6718 4 роки тому +2

    I've created an NPM package for a design system. It was fairly straightforward except dealing with fonts was kind of a nightmare for some reason. Love this course since I was trying to figure out how to do tests of the package within the repo. Also created npx garrettbear in the mean time. Thanks!

  • @rogerpence
    @rogerpence 4 роки тому

    Thank you very much, James. Your vid was _very_ helpful. Concise, clear, quick, and enlightening.

  • @GradeFX
    @GradeFX 4 роки тому +1

    wow that was a really nice introduction.
    Thank you very much!

  • @ansumanmishra9608
    @ansumanmishra9608 3 роки тому

    Great explanation! Covered most of the basic things. Thanks and keep up the good work :)

  • @devegram
    @devegram 4 роки тому

    You have highlighted points that aren't being told in another tutorials 👍

  • @MRAMetharam
    @MRAMetharam 2 роки тому

    Awesome content! Thanx for sharing!

  • @saikrishnakadali5813
    @saikrishnakadali5813 Рік тому

    great explanation!

  • @restuwahyusaputra7764
    @restuwahyusaputra7764 4 роки тому

    Awesome, thanks for this tutorial very helpful for me

  • @rahul.murari
    @rahul.murari 4 роки тому

    Thanks, Really helpful ❤️

  • @alexodan
    @alexodan Рік тому +1

    I created a react component and trying to publish for practice, but the styles are not applying and the types are not exporting lol I wish it was this straightforward

  • @shubhamsinghvi1107
    @shubhamsinghvi1107 2 роки тому

    I did 'npm link' from project directory and 'npm link ' from tester but in tester node-modules folder the documents were open as in they were not in a folder naming my like the other npm packages with folder and the modules inside, how to make that possible ?

  • @sergem1674
    @sergem1674 3 роки тому

    so took me a couple of hours to sort through this. I was trying to figure out publishing scoped packages. It turns out you need to make sure your email address is verified in order for you to publish. you can figure that out by running the command `npm profile get`

  • @monireol
    @monireol 4 роки тому

    Thanks man

  • @cm3462
    @cm3462 5 місяців тому

    idk why, but while
    'npm unlink' didn't work per 'npm list -g'
    'npm unilnk -g' worked

  • @kevingreetham5883
    @kevingreetham5883 3 роки тому

    Hi James. Great content. Can an npm package consist of html and css files? Thanks bro

  • @galamar84
    @galamar84 4 роки тому

    Must ask, what theme are you using?

  • @AbdoTech0
    @AbdoTech0 4 роки тому

    i love the dog

  • @darrenz5557
    @darrenz5557 3 роки тому

    why npx keeps installing???

  • @BreadcrumbMC
    @BreadcrumbMC 4 роки тому

    discord.js

    • @JamesQQuick
      @JamesQQuick  4 роки тому

      What about it?

    • @BreadcrumbMC
      @BreadcrumbMC 4 роки тому +1

      James Q Quick you said to comment your favorite package

  • @braybilly
    @braybilly 2 роки тому

    jamesqquick is my favorite npm package :)